<TABLE>
                                                                  FORM 13F INFORMATION TABLE
                                                           VALUE   SHARES/  SH/ PUT/ INVSTMT    OTHER          VOTING AUTHORITY
        NAME OF ISSUER          TITLE OF CLASS    CUSIP   (x$1000) PRN AMT  PRN CALL DSCRETN   MANAGERS     SOLE    SHARED    NONE
------------------------------ ---------------- --------- -------- -------- --- ---- ------- ------------ -------- -------- --------
<S>                            <C>              <C>       <C>      <C>      <C> <C>  <C>     <C>          <C>      <C>      <C>
3M Co.                         Common Stock     88579Y101      518     8626 SH       SOLE                     8626
AT&T Corp.                     Common Stock     00206R102     1485    59766 SH       SOLE                    59766
Accenture LTD                  Common Stock     G1150G111     2381    71145 SH       SOLE                    71145
Alexanders, Inc.               Common Stock     014752109      270     1000 SH       SOLE                     1000
Apache Corp                    Common Stock     037411105     9281   128630 SH       SOLE                   128630
Apple Inc.                     Common Stock     037833100    11361    79766 SH       SOLE                    79766
Automatic Data Processing      Common Stock     053015103     9117   257250 SH       SOLE                   257250
Bank of New York Mellon Corp.  Common Stock     064058100     7199   245606 SH       SOLE                   245606
Berkshire Hathaway Cl. B       Common Stock     084670207    10743     3710 SH       SOLE                     3710
CVS Caremark Corp.             Common Stock     126650100     6976   218882 SH       SOLE                   218882
Chevron Corp.                  Common Stock     166764100      332     5014 SH       SOLE                     5014
Cincinnati Financial           Common Stock     172062101      220     9853 SH       SOLE                     9853
Cisco Systems Inc.             Common Stock     17275R102     9879   529686 SH       SOLE                   529686
Coca-Cola                      Common Stock     191216100     9108   189780 SH       SOLE                   189780
ConocoPhillips                 Common Stock     20825C104      216     5140 SH       SOLE                     5140
Diageo PLC                     Common Stock     25243Q106      275     4800 SH       SOLE                     4800
Disney, Walt & Co.             Common Stock     254687106     9464   405663 SH       SOLE                   405663
EOG Resoures, Inc.             Common Stock     26875P101     8107   119360 SH       SOLE                   119360
Emerson Electric               Common Stock     291011104     8273   255335 SH       SOLE                   255335
Exelon Corp.                   Common Stock     30161N101     7751   151365 SH       SOLE                   151365
Exxon Mobil Corp.              Common Stock     30231G102     3437    49160 SH       SOLE                    49160
Ford Motor                     Common Stock     345370860       65    10768 SH       SOLE                    10768
Freeport McMoran Copper & Gold Common Stock     35671D857     7160   142878 SH       SOLE                   142878
General Electric               Common Stock     369604103      511    43565 SH       SOLE                    43565
Goldman Sachs Group            Common Stock     38141G104     6096    41349 SH       SOLE                    41349
Google, Inc.                   Common Stock     38259P508     2608     6185 SH       SOLE                     6185
Halliburton                    Common Stock     406216101     6659   321667 SH       SOLE                   321667
Harley Davidson Inc            Common Stock     412822108     5994   369750 SH       SOLE                   369750
Hewlett Packard                Common Stock     428236103     9665   250063 SH       SOLE                   250063
IBM                            Common Stock     459200101    11381   108989 SH       SOLE                   108989
IR BioSciences Holdings, Inc.  Common Stock     46264M303        2    10000 SH       SOLE                    10000
JPMorgan Chase & Co.           Common Stock     46625H100     7318   214535 SH       SOLE                   214535
Johnson & Johnson              Common Stock     478160104    12472   219575 SH       SOLE                   219575
McDonalds Corp.                Common Stock     580135101     9265   161166 SH       SOLE                   161166
Medco Health Solutions Inc.    Common Stock     58405U102     6501   142541 SH       SOLE                   142541
Microsoft Corp                 Common Stock     594918104      373    15708 SH       SOLE                    15708
Nestle S.A. Sp ADR             Common Stock     641069406     7951   211357 SH       SOLE                   211357
Noble Energy, Inc.             Common Stock     655044105     5235    88775 SH       SOLE                    88775
Occidental Petroleum           Common Stock     674599105     7179   109090 SH       SOLE                   109090
Oracle Corp.                   Common Stock     68389X105     8337   389195 SH       SOLE                   389195
Owens Illinois, Inc.           Common Stock     690768403      645    23025 SH       SOLE                    23025
Pepsico Inc.                   Common Stock     713448108      207     3766 SH       SOLE                     3766
Petroleo Brasileiro SA - ADR   Common Stock     71654V408      249     6070 SH       SOLE                     6070
Petroleo Brasileiro SA - ADR   Common Stock     71654V101     4372   131055 SH       SOLE                   131055
Proctor & Gamble               Common Stock     742718109     9228   180586 SH       SOLE                   180586
Royal Dutch Shell PLC-AD       Common Stock     780259206      266     5300 SH       SOLE                     5300
Teva Pharm. ADR                Common Stock     881624209    12385   251021 SH       SOLE                   251021
UCBH Holdings Inc.             Common Stock     90262T308       45    35947 SH       SOLE                    35947
Union Pacific                  Common Stock     907818108     5460   104880 SH       SOLE                   104880
Unit Corporation               Common Stock     909218109     2592    94000 SH       SOLE                    94000
Utility Holders SM Trust       Common Stock     918019100     1492    16400 SH       SOLE                    16400
Vornado REIT                   Common Stock     929042109      366     8119 SH       SOLE                     8119
Wal Mart Stores Inc.           Common Stock     931142103     8569   176897 SH       SOLE                   176897
Wyeth                          Common Stock     983024100      310     6837 SH       SOLE                     6837
Midcap SPDR Trust Series 1                      595635103      417     3967 SH       SOLE                     3967
SPDR Trust Series 1                             78462F103      734     7982 SH       SOLE                     7982
Sector SPDR Fincl Select Share                  81369Y605      669    56000 SH       SOLE                    56000
Vanguard Financials ETF                         92204A405      533    22125 SH       SOLE                    22125
Vanguard Small-Cap Growth ETF                   922908595      264     5500 SH       SOLE                     5500
iShares S&P Mid-Cap 400 Index                   464287507      491     8491 SH       SOLE                     8491
iShares MSCI EAFE                               464287465      411     8980 SH       SOLE                     8980
Ishares MSCI Emerging Markets                   464287234      376    11675 SH       SOLE                    11675
iShares MSCI Brazil Index ETF                   464286400     2085    39370 SH       SOLE                    39370
Cohen & Steers Intern Rlty Cla                  19248H401      316 33756.813SH       SOLE                33756.813
DNP Select Income FD                            23325P104      115 14437.000SH       SOLE                14437.000
Franklin Income Fund A                          353496300       41 22771.214SH       SOLE                22771.214
Vanguard Federal Money Market                   922906300       62 62118.500SH       SOLE                62118.500
IShares Lehman US TIPS                          464287176      872     8575 SH       SOLE                     8575
</TABLE>